AUTC And Blissful Transformation Donate Breathalyzers To LNP

Africa Union Trading Company, in partnership with Blissful Transformation Company in Liberia, has donated breathalyzers to the headquarters of the Liberia National Police (LNP) recently. The donation of the companies shows their commitment in addressing the challenges confronting the LNP, and were presented by officials from the both companies.

   Addressing the Liberia National Police (LNP) was Pastor Jimmy Philips, head of the delegates to the LNP, who assured Police Inspector, Col. Gregory Coleman, and senior LNP officers during the presentation ceremony that their companies stand prepared to provide the necessary support to the government and people of Liberia in addressing such challenges.

   According to him, the items donated serve as a start of friendship between their companies and the LNP.

   He said that they believe that the items donated will be used by the LNP in combating crime when it comes to implementing standards and disciplines.

   Africa Union Trading Company and Blissful Transformation Companies have been around for some time now in Liberia, providing the necessary support to the government and people of Liberia since their establishment.

   For his part, Police IG, Gregory Coleman, reaffirmed the Liberia National Police’s commitment in combating crime in Liberia. He promised to use the donated materials for their intended purpose.

   The items donated were accommodated by officials from the both companies, including Pastor Jimmy Philips, head of delegation, Pastor Obunikem Justin Ndebueze, member of board of directors at AUTC, and Alice Fleming, Coordinator at the Nursing Department at AUTC.

   AUTC and Blissful Transformation Companies are owned and operated by Sgt. Eric Oppong Twum and Sierra Twum, both of whom reside abroad.
